Speed Calculation: Compare 4 Toy Cars Moving at Different Distance-Time Rates

Question

In the toy store, they want to test which toy car is the fastest
These are the test results:
Car A - 4m in 0.5 seconds.
Car B - 3m in 30 seconds.
Car C - in 4.5 seconds 38m.
Car D - in 2 seconds 15m.

Order the cars from fastest to slowest

Step-by-Step Solution

First, let's calculate the speed of each toy car using the formula Speed=DistanceTime \text{Speed} = \frac{\text{Distance}}{\text{Time}} .

  • For Car A: SpeedA=4 m0.5 s=8 m/s\text{Speed}_A = \frac{4 \text{ m}}{0.5 \text{ s}} = 8 \text{ m/s}
  • For Car B: SpeedB=3 m30 s=0.1 m/s\text{Speed}_B = \frac{3 \text{ m}}{30 \text{ s}} = 0.1 \text{ m/s}
  • For Car C: SpeedC=38 m4.5 s8.44 m/s\text{Speed}_C = \frac{38 \text{ m}}{4.5 \text{ s}} \approx 8.44 \text{ m/s}
  • For Car D: SpeedD=15 m2 s=7.5 m/s\text{Speed}_D = \frac{15 \text{ m}}{2 \text{ s}} = 7.5 \text{ m/s}

After calculating the speeds, we can order the cars from fastest to slowest by comparing their speeds:

  • Car C: 8.44 m/s
  • Car A: 8 m/s
  • Car D: 7.5 m/s
  • Car B: 0.1 m/s

Therefore, the fastest car is Car C, followed by Car A, Car D, and the slowest is Car B.
